Minutes — Pricing Committee

Attendees: exec team plus incoming director (observing). Decision: legacy Corvette-tier customers of Halden Systems move to current list pricing over two billing cycles. Estimated uplift: 9%. Risk: attrition among long-tenure accounts; retention offers approved for top fifty. Comms drafted, pending legal sign-off. Incoming director to own rollout from next month. Context for the decision is set out in the note below.

internal memo for yahag-hahig: Belwynix Group plans to lower the Silir list price by 62 percent in May.

**Changelog — Brightcrop v4.2: EXIF scrubbing defaults changed**

Heads up for the release notes: EXIF scrubbing is now on by default for all uploads, not just the public-gallery tier. We kept camera make/model but strip GPS and serial fields unless the uploader opts out. A few partners who relied on orientation tags already got pinged, so expect some noise in the first week. The scrubber now ships with these default values:

config for kafof-bawef:
holath:
  log_level: debug
  metrics_host: metrics.holath.qorvelsys.internal
  pin: 2191
  pool_size: 32

The test-data factory library has generated records that no longer match the current Ledgerline schema — usually means a migration landed without a matching factory update. Builds on the Quillbrook pipeline will fail fast once this fires. Do not silence it; stale factories mask real regressions. Check the last three schema migrations first, then regenerate the factory snapshots. Details on diagnosing which factory definitions drifted, plus the regeneration procedure, are kept on the internal runbook page below.

operations page: https://jenkins.zemvarcloud.local/job/merge_requests/repo/build/73930b4b30f0a8ed

Subject: Handover — Pointsmith ledger release

Hey, quick handover before I'm out. The loyalty-points ledger migration is staged but not applied; run it after the 02:00 settlement batch or balances will skew. Reconciliation job is paused on purpose — unpause it once the migration finishes clean. If anything looks off, roll back, don't patch live. Artifacts for this release are signed with the key below.

release key, fahaf-bajof: bky3_Xam